The US government is investing $1.6 billion in USA Rare Earth to develop a Texas mine and an Oklahoma magnet manufacturing facility. This move aims to reduce reliance on China for critical minerals essential for high-tech products and national security. The investment includes federal funding and a significant loan, with the Commerce Department taking a minority stake in the company.

Published on: Jan. 26, 2026, 3:48 p.m. | Source:
scanx.trade
India's private space industry is seeking critical infrastructure status and increased government procurement ahead of the Union Budget. The Indian Space Association and Deloitte recommend recognising space assets as distinct infrastructure to unlock private investment and competitiveness. Industry leaders want formal procurement mandates, reduced taxes on specialised components, and expanded funding for deep-tech missions, citing international models where NASA and ESA procure 80-90% from private companies.

Bank of Baroda Plans $500 Million Offshore Bond Issue Under Medium-Term Note Programme
Published on: Jan. 26, 2026, 3:11 p.m. | Source:
scanx.trade
Bank of Baroda is preparing to raise $500 million through US dollar bonds under its $4 billion medium-term note programme, inviting bids for joint lead managers. The Reg-S bond issue will target non-US investors and may be executed in multiple tranches based on market conditions. Proceeds will fund overseas operations and refinance existing liabilities as part of the bank's foreign currency funding strategy.
